A due diligence checklist is an organized way to analyze a company that you are acquiring through sale, merger, or another method. By following this checklist, you can learn about a company's assets, liabilities, contracts, benefits, and potential problems.

Other examples of hard due diligence activities include:Reviewing and auditing financial statements.Scrutinizing projections for future performance.Analyzing the consumer market.Seeking operating redundancies that can be eliminated.Reviewing potential or ongoing litigation.Reviewing antitrust considerations.More items...

What Should Be in a Due Diligence Report Checklist?Information on the finances of the company.Information about the company's employees.Information on the assets of the company.Information on partners, suppliers, and customers.Legal information about the company.
